The determinant factors influencing accounting students’ interest in tax career
Abstrak
This research is to examine the influences of professional perception, self-ability, career expectation, and brevet tax training on the students’ interest in tax career. The population of this research is Class 2017 and Class 2018 students of Accounting Study Program of Universitas Islam Indonesia. The number of samples is 90 students who were collected using purposive sampling method based on the criteria of having completed the taxation subject and brevet tax training. The data processing tool employed was IBM SPSS version 25. The findings show that professional perception, career expectation, and brevet tax training positively affect the interest of accounting students to have career in tax. However, self-ability does not show any influence on the students’ interest to have career in tax. This Research is expected to be a consideration for educational institutios to motivate students to have a career in taxation.
